KUALA LUMPUR – 117 Covid-19 patients succumbed to the disease yesterday.

Based on the date provided by COVIDNOW, 16 were Brought In Dead (BID) cases, where the deceased passed away before they managed to get treatment at the hospital.

A cumulative of 26,876 Covid-19 deaths have been reported in the country.

Sarawak recorded the highest deaths with 21 cases, followed by Johor (19), Perak and Selangor that recorded 14 deaths each. Meanwhile, Kelantan and Sabah recorded 11 cases respectively.

Other states recorded less than 10 Covid-19 deaths. Kedah (8), Terengganu (5), Pahang (4), Kuala Lumpur (4), Melaka (2), Perlis (2), Negri Sembilan (1) and Penang (1).

Meanwhile, no death was reported in Labuan and Putrajaya.

At the same time, there are currently 135,945 active Covid-19 cases in the country, a drop of 23.1 percent compared to last week.

From the amount of active cases, 846 cases are admitted into the Intensive Care Unit (ICU) while 441 required respiratory support. -MalaysiaGazette
